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Burdock Conch | small tortoiseshell |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(動物) | Animalia (動物) |
| Phylum same | Arthropoda (節足動物) | Arthropoda (節足動物) |
| Class same | Insecta (昆虫) | Insecta (昆虫) |
| Order same | Lepidoptera (チョウ目) | Lepidoptera (チョウ目) |
| Family | Tortricidae | Nymphalidae (Brush-footed Butterflies) |
| Genus | Aethes | Aglais |
| Species | Aethes rubigana | Aglais urticae |
Evolutionary Relationship
Burdock Conch and small tortoiseshell share a common ancestor at the Order level: Lepidoptera. (チョウ目)
